      Hi. I have classic 5 gallon tank and don’t have a space for another tank. Saying it because I’m worried of crabs breeding. I don’t have space to keep babies. I was thinking keeping 2 females. Do you think that is daft or ok idea?
      Side question that I have not seen anyone anywhere answering: which geosesarma is best?

    • @IndoorEcosystem
      @IndoorEcosystem  19 дней назад +1

      @@kingwenceslas4225 Females together is fine though you may still get babies depending on if they are pregnant when you get them so there is always a chance. But don't worry too much about babies the parents eat their young pretty quickly so the population stays in check without any effort.
      As for which species is the best there's no real answer. Most people don't have the luxury to choice from a big selection so just get whatever they can.
      There are a few slightly different characteristic between some species (molting on land and climbing more) but other than that they are basically all the same. The most important thing is not mixing any species/colours are they will fight and murder each other pretty fast.

    What about tanks that go straight up and 12x12x24

    • @IndoorEcosystem
      @IndoorEcosystem  2 месяца назад +1

      Vertical tanks are a lot more complicated to build successfully for the crabs. Not impossible but more advanced. If you're new it's best to start with standard long style tanks rather than vertical ones. I cover this in the viceo. 12x12x24 has too small of a base though I wouldn't use one this big. 18x18x? Is the smallest base you want for a vertical build.

    For a ten gallon tank, if I keep your recommended 1 male, 2 females, is overpopulation with the baby crabs going to be a problem? Aka will enough of them survive to adulthood that I'd have to make a second setup? I plan on getting my first crabs when the weather warms up, but don't feel ready to deal with breeding.

    • @IndoorEcosystem
      @IndoorEcosystem  8 месяцев назад

      It depends a little bit on the complexity of the tank but a lot will get eaten as they grow slowly. I'm currently testing this scenario right now but need more time for a proper result. But I don't think there will be a major population issue looking at how it's going so far. Worst case scenario though you can take them to your local fish store for cred it $ usually.

    Do you think it’s possible to keep a single crab or pair of female/male?

    • @IndoorEcosystem
      @IndoorEcosystem  4 месяца назад +1

      A single crab is not ideal. Even though they bicker and fight in groups they need company. You'd probably never see your solo crab. He'd be hiding 99% of the time.
      A pair is doable but comes with risk. The male can over apply himself to the female and wear her down until she dies.
      That's why 3 usually works best, 1 male 2 females. Everything is shared around and balanced out.
      Just don't go smaller than a 5 gallon tank (long) They need space for territory and evasion as well.
